Description
(Rs)-4,4,4-Trifluoro-3-Hydroxybutyric Acid CAS NO 86884-21-1 is a high-value chiral fluorinated building block essential for advanced organic synthesis. This compound is critical for introducing the trifluoromethyl-hydroxybutyrate moiety, a key structural motif that can significantly alter the physicochemical and metabolic properties of target molecules. It is primarily sought after by research and development teams in the pharmaceutical and agrochemical industries for the creation of novel active ingredients.
Application
- Pharmaceutical Intermediate: A key chiral synthon for the research and development of new active pharmaceutical ingredients (APIs), particularly in metabolic disease and central nervous system (CNS) therapeutic areas.
- Agrochemical Synthesis: Used in the design and production of advanced herbicides and pesticides, where the fluorine atoms enhance biological activity and environmental stability.
- Ligand and Catalyst Development: Serves as a precursor for chiral ligands and organocatalysts used in asymmetric synthesis.
- Material Science Research: Employed in the synthesis of fluorinated polymers and specialty chemicals with unique surface properties.
- Biochemical Research: Acts as a substrate or inhibitor analog in enzymatic studies, leveraging its structural similarity to natural metabolites.
- Fluorine Chemistry: A versatile starting material for exploring new fluorination methodologies and creating complex fluorinated architectures.
Basic Information
| Product Name | (Rs)-4,4,4-Trifluoro-3-Hydroxybutyric Acid |
| CAS No. | 86884-21-1 |
| Molecular Formula | C4H5F3O3 |
| Molecular Weight | 158.08 g/mol |
| Synonyms | (R,S)-4,4,4-Trifluoro-3-hydroxybutanoic Acid; (±)-4,4,4-Trifluoro-3-hydroxybutyric Acid; DL-4,4,4-Trifluoro-3-hydroxybutyric Acid; 3-Hydroxy-4,4,4-trifluorobutanoic Acid; 4,4,4-Trifluoro-3-hydroxybutanoic Acid; rac-4,4,4-Trifluoro-3-hydroxybutyric Acid; TFHBA |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place. Due to its hygroscopic nature, the container should be kept sealed under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to prevent moisture absorption and potential degradation. Recommended storage temperature is 2-8°C.
